About Promedica

Promedica is a non-profit healthcare system that operates 13 hospitals and over 300 other facilities in Ohio and Michigan. The system employs over 13,000 physicians and other healthcare professionals, and serves over 2 million patients annually. Promedica's mission is to improve the health and well-being of the communities it serves, and it is committed to providing high-quality, compassionate care to all patients, regardless of their ability to pay. The system offers a wide range of medical services, including primary care, specialty care, and advanced treatments for complex conditions. Promedica is also involved in medical research and education, and partners with other organizations to promote community health and wellness.
